Types of Party-Wear Lehenga Choli you’ll love:
When it’s about dressing for the festive season or any party, a party wear lehenga never fails to make a statement. Whether it’s a cocktail party, a reception dinner or even a festive get-together, a stellar party lehenga dress can elevate your entire look without taking much effort.
Some popular lehenga styles you can check for this wedding season are:
- Embroidered lehengas: Great for weddings and high-glam events, these intricately embellished lehengas combine indian heritage embroidery of zardozi, threadwork and much more are ideal for women who love fine craftsmanship.
- Banarasi Party wear lehengas: A fine amalgamation of banarasi weaving with modern silhouette. Rich fabrics, bold colours and outstanding motif work make the party wear Banarasi lehenga a classic choice for festive nights and family gatherings.
- Printed party wear lehenga: Light-weight, flowy lehengas are the perfect choice for small parties and get-togethers. They are fun and vibrant, and thus a printed party lehenga for women is a hit for younger women and brides for their haldi-mehendi ceremony.
- Sequin & mirror work lehenga: Ideal for sangeet nights and cocktail parties, these lehengas shimmer and mark a lively experience under flashing lights. If you're looking for a glamorous party wear dress lehenga, this is it.
- Silk lehengas: A preference among mature ladies for winter weddings, they give a regal look with their rich fabrics and sheen appearance.
- Organza Lehengas: This easy-breezy lehenga style is a perfect party wear lehenga for girls and women who want to look stylish yet comfortable in any party or event.
- Net lehengas: An apt lehenga type for our dearest bridesmaids as they are quite versatile and easy to carry.

Party-Wear lehenga choli Suitable for different occasions:
Sangeet Nights: Go for flowy, light-weight silehouttes that will make you groove and let you dance your heart out. Bright colours, mirror work, and fun patterns are what the trend is for party lehenga for women.
Reception parties: The reception celebration calls for some regal appearance so make sure you carry a rich fabric like Raw silk or banarasi lehenga with ornate embellishments. Pair it with heavy jewellery and bangles or chooda for that grand look.
Festivals & traditional ceremonies: Choose rich fabrics in traditional motifs. Bright colours and cultural elements keep the spirit alive while maintaining style.
Cocktail Parties: Such events demand modern designs and a bit of glamour. Opt for metallic tones with a structured flair. For blouses you can go for corset styles, off-shoulder cholis and even a muted tone contrasting blouse. A sequin or satin party wear dress lehenga gives you the perfect contemporary edge.

Styling Party Wear lehengas: Designer Recommendations:
All the lehenga dress for party are excellent designs but how can you make yourself stand out from the rest with a jaw-dropping appearance? Here are some tips from our in-house designers that you can follow while styling your outfit.
Shoe-Pairing suggestions:
- Go for juttis and embellished heels for indian outfits.
- For contemporary outfits like gowns and cocktail dresses, pick some metallic tone sandals or block heels.
- For banarasi lehengas or sarees, you can opt for wedges and kohlapuris.
Matching dupatta & blouse:
- Matching blouses can be bit boring at times, so you can always colour block your outfit with a contrasting blouse. Like a purple lehenga will look even prettier with a contrasting lime green choli.
- Silk lehengas go well with brocade designs. Pick a one in some contemporary hue to give that edge to your outfit.
- Dupattas are an important element of a party wear design lehenega choli. So, make sure you match your dupatta and accentuate your look.
Jewellery choices:
- Accessories play a vital role in pulling the look together so do not take them for granted and pick your accessories wisely.
- While bracelets are the most common choices to pair instead of bangles. But the old-school charm of a good set of bangles is totally unmatched.
- Jhumkas, studded earrings and even earcuffs are all designed for different styles of outfits. Opt for jhumkas when you’re planning on full desi vibes and go for earcuffs and studs if your outfit demands an indo-western appeal.
Fabric recommendations:
- Now we all know that silk and velvet are for winter festivities and cooler months as they are bit warmer and elude that richness.
- Summers call for breathable and light-weight fabrics like georgette with soothing chikankari work or a chiffon lehenga with cutdana and sequins.
- Try crepe or satin for their quick-drying, non-clingy properties.

How to wear lehenga for short girls?
Short girls can always slay a lehenga by styling it in a right way. Go for high-waisted skirts and a short choli. If you are petite and short, make sure to choose a lehenga with small motifs and intricate embroidery as it gives and illusion of appearing tall.
Going for a monotone lehenga can be a smart move as it virtually adds height.
